Orders of Magnitude are in terms of scientific notation.

23,000 written in scientific notation is 2.3 x 10^4, it's magnitude is 4 ( the number 10 is raised to)

56 in scientific notation would be 5.6 x 10^1, its magnitude is 1.

4 - 1 = 3

2300 is 3 order of magnitudes larger.

The answer is 3.
